Description

The 60-Day Notice of Termination of Residential Month-to-Month Tenancy is a crucial document for landlords in California, particularly for those managing tenants who have resided on the property for at least one year. This form informs tenants that their lease will not be renewed and specifies that they must vacate the premises within 60 days of receiving the notice. It is essential for landlords to provide this notice to meet legal requirements outlined in California Civil Code §1946.1(b). Users of this form must fill in details such as the tenant's name, the address of the leased premises, and the date of delivery. After delivering the notice, the individual responsible for delivery must complete the Proof of Delivery section, which includes obtaining signatures when possible.
